PixMob is one of the world’s leaders in creating immersive experiences for live events. You might have seen 60,000 people lighting up at the Super Bowl. Or at a Coldplay concert. Our goal is to reinvent rituals to connect crowds. We call that ‘togetherness’.

We work with international artists, event organizers, sports teams and brands who care about creating unique & memorable experiences for their guests. PixMob is rooted in design and innovation. Alongside our customers, we reinvent immersive experiences through advanced wireless technologies engineered in-house, at our Montreal HQ. From rapid-prototyping to mass-manufacturing, we are fully vertically integrated to keep pushing the boundaries of the possible. We are leading the way with our sustainability efforts as we have been fighting against single-use plastics. We focus our efforts on using recycled or plant-based compostable materials and encouraging our clients to recycle our products.
